How much do cpg part time j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for cpg part time in the United States is $17.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.62 and $18.27 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Cpg Part Time position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a CPG (Consumer Packaged Goods) Part Time employee, you need a solid understanding of retail operations, inventory management, and basic merchandising principles,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with retail management systems, planogram software, and handheld inventory devices is often beneficial. Strong communication, time management, and attention to detail help individuals stand out in this customer-facing, dynamic environment. These skills are important for ensuring product displays are organized, inventory is accurately tracked, and customers receive excellent service, all of which drive sales success.

What types of tasks and responsibilities can I expect in a CPG Part Time role?

In a CPG Part Time role, you can expect to be responsible for stocking shelves, setting up promotional displays, monitoring product inventory, and ensuring correct merchandising according to company standards. You may also interact with store staff and customers, answer product questions, and report back on stock levels or sales trends. Many part-time CPG employees work independently but coordinate closely with store managers or sales representatives. This role is ideal if you enjoy working in a retail environment and are comfortable with a mix of physical and customer-focused tasks.

What is a CPG Part-Time job?

A CPG Part-Time job typically involves working with consumer packaged goods (CPG) companies to assist with sales, merchandising, or marketing on a part-time basis. Responsibilities may include stocking shelves, setting up displays, conducting store audits, or promoting products. These roles are often flexible and can be found in retail stores, grocery chains, or through third-party merchandising companies.
